Output ef2ec0d55cd1179c03d680a60da7a489c03029eb2c48c95ea6abe95d5948e12e:0

value
657439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b30fbd4aa45778ec0952963dbd6b8024a567d4da OP_EQUAL
address
3J1ojUXnhy8rJjrjcQgwm2cu4GRgTszF6K
transaction
ef2ec0d55cd1179c03d680a60da7a489c03029eb2c48c95ea6abe95d5948e12e
confirmations
118608
spent
true